Neapolitan
Riviera
With stunning views and scenery, Sorrento and Amalfi provide the
perfect backdrop for a wedding. Positano boasts a dramatic position,
carved into a spectacular cliff. As one of the most elegant retreats
on the Amalfi Coast, it is the ideal choice for a sophisticated
wedding. Slightly inland, Ravello undoubtedly enjoys the best
views on this coastline and is unrivalled in its location, providing
a magical setting for a wedding. The islands of Capri and Ischia
enjoy striking views and spectacular scenery. With its picturesque
harbor, Capri is a fantastic choice for a captivating wedding
day. Ischia is renowned for its fine sandy beaches and therapeutic
health spas. Combining the two islands could provide the perfect
wedding and honeymoon package.
Cities
Rome, “The Eternal City”, steeped in history and bursting
with culture, is the perfect choice for a sophisticated and elegant
wedding day. Venice has remained a timeless city whose beauty
never fails to amaze us, and its undisputed romance secures its
place as a popular wedding choice. Florence, a city dominated
by art and history, makes a classic wedding backdrop. As the setting
for Shakespeare's Romeo and Juliet, Verona cannot fail to impress
those looking for a wedding in the most romantic of locations.
The
Lakes
With their enchanting mix of scenery, the Italian lakes make an
excellent wedding choice for those who want a backdrop bursting
with color and natural beauty.

Services Included:
• Wedding ceremony
• Town hall registry fee and consular fee
• Assistance of a wedding coordinator throughout
• English-speaking interpreter for the declarations &
ceremony (performed in Italian)
• Assistance with paperwork at Consulate & Town Hall
• Administrative handling of paperwork & the marriage
certificate
• Posy for the bride and buttonhole for the groom
• VAT taxes
Additional Services Available:
In addition to basic packages, we can arrange extra services
which are payable locally in Italy.
• Flowers, bouquet
• Music for the ceremony
• Photographer and video/DVD service
• Horse and carriage
• Beauty services
• Private car transfers
